How had tax lien impacted the credit score in the past?
Tax liens were often negative to the credit report in the past. First, a tax lien was a negative mark that appeared on your credit report for up to seven years. This means that no one was able to use your credit report until the tax lien has been paid or paid off.

When you had a tax lien on your credit report, it's best not to apply for new loans or lines of credit while this was still on your credit report. Even if the lien was paid off, it may take some time before the account was removed from your report and you could get new loans approved again.

After 2017, the tax lien no longer appears on the credit report. Having a tax lien was damaging to your credit score since it appeared on your credit report for up to seven years.
